The 2024 World Athletics Indoor Track and Field Championships continued on March 2 in Glasgow, Scotland at the Emirates Arena. Like the first day, events are split into sessions, the morning and afternoon. The day started with the men’s long jump finals as Miltiadis Tentoglou, a 2020 Olympian from Greece, won gold. The Heptathlon began as well as semifinals for the 800 meters and heats for the 60 meters. The afternoon session will start at 2:05 p.m. On Day 1 of the meet, Christian Coleman won the Men’s 60 meter championship and with a word leading time of 6,41 seconds. A recent study conducted by travel planning website TripIt revealed that pop culture-inspired trips will double next year, with younger generations leading the trend. Pop culture travel can include everything from trips to see concerts in another city or country to “set jet” trips to visit overseas filming locations for your favorite movies and TV series. yeah.
